Joydrop was a Canadian rock band in the late 1990s and early 2000s. The band consisted of vocalist Tara Slone, guitarist Thomas Payne, bassist Tom McKay and drummer Tony Rabalao.

The band released two CDs, Metasexual and Viberate, and had notable chart hits in Canada with "Beautiful" and "Sometimes Wanna Die".

Following the band's breakup, Slone released a solo album, and was a contestant on Rock Star: INXS. Tony Rabalao also went solo and put out a CD under the name Lehlo but plays in Tara's band as well. Tom McKay is a producer and worked on Tara's and Tony's CDs. Thomas Payne is writing and producing with other artists.
